在前端開發中,我們經常需要從服務器端獲取異步數據,而axios是一個非常流行的實現此功能的庫。下面我們來探討一下如何使用axios來獲取異步JSON數據。
首先,在我們的HTML文件中引入axios庫:
<script src="https://cdn.jsdelivr.net/npm/axios/dist/axios.min.js"></script>
接著,我們可以使用axios的API來獲取異步JSON數據。比如下面的代碼演示了如何從服務器端獲取名字為“John”的用戶的信息:
// 發送get請求
axios.get('/user?name=John')
.then(function (response) {
// 在此處處理返回的數據
console.log(response.data);
})
.catch(function (error) {
// 在此處處理請求失敗情況
console.log(error);
});
在上述代碼中,我們使用了axios.get來發送一個get請求,請求的URL是/user?name=John。如果成功獲取數據,就會執行then方法中的回調函數,我們可以在這里處理返回的數據。
如果請求失敗,就會執行catch方法中的回調函數,我們可以在這里處理請求失敗的情況。
總之,使用axios獲取異步JSON數據非常簡單,只需要使用axios的API來發送請求即可。希望這篇文章對你有所幫助,謝謝閱讀!
下一篇css 設置文本距離